How does roof ventilation affect my home's health and energy costs?

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ates attic temperatures exceeding 150°F, baking shingles from beneath. The 2015 IRC with Wisconsin amendments requires 1:150 net free area ratio, with balanced intake at eaves and exhaust at ridge. Inadequate airflow causes moisture accumulation on pine plank decking, leading to mold growth and wood rot. Proper ventilation reduces attic temperature by 30-40°, extending shingle life and lowering cooling costs 8-12% annually.

What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Palmyra's severe thunderstorms?

Palmyra's 115 mph wind zone requires shingles with ASTM D7158 Class H rating and six-nail installation patterns. Class 4 impact-resistant shingles withstand 2-inch hail strikes common during May-August peak season, preventing granule loss that exposes asphalt to UV degradation. These shingles maintain waterproofing integrity after impacts, reducing insurance claims by 30-40%. Properly installed, they meet ASCE 7-22 wind uplift requirements for 3-second gust events.

What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Jefferson County?

Jefferson County Zoning & Building Department enforces 2015 IRC with Wisconsin Uniform Dwelling Code amendments. Wisconsin DSPS licensing requires ice and water shield extending 24 inches inside exterior walls, doubled in valleys. Flashing must integrate with waterproof underlayment, with step flashing minimum 4x4 inches. These 2026 standards address Palmyra's freeze-thaw cycles by preventing ice dam water intrusion at eaves. Unpermitted work voids warranties and insurance coverage for storm damage.
